I Remember Everything, Richard is a 1966 film produced during Soviet period at the Riga Film Studio. Another name for the film is Rock and Splinters , which is normally applied to the uncut version.

The film's director was Rolands Kalniņš

Cast

The film's cast featured several important Latvian actors: Eduards Pāvuls, Antra Liedskalniņa, Harijs Liepiņš, Pauls Butkēvičs, Uldis Pūcītis.
